About Brownthwaite

Escape to the serene setting of Brownthwaite, a luxurious retreat nestled in the picturesque Fell View Park, Lancashire. This ground-floor lodge is the perfect sanctuary for couples seeking a romantic getaway amidst the Yorkshire Dales and Lake District National Park.

The accommodation boasts a cosy studio layout with a plush king-size bed, a kitchenette equipped with a 2-ring hob and microwave, and an inviting sitting area complete with a woodburning stove.

The modern shower room ensures a refreshing start to your day of exploration.

Step outside onto your private decking, where you can sizzle up a feast on the gas barbecue and later, immerse yourself in the bubbling hot tub under the stars. With off-road parking for convenience, this idyllic spot sleeps two and promises a memorable stay.

Getting there

To get to Brownthwaite, take the M6 motorway to junction 36 and follow signs to Kirkby Lonsdale via the A65. The nearest train station is Oxenholme Lake District, which has connections to major cities.

Quickfire FAQs

Does this accommodation feature a hot tub?

Yes, the accommodation includes a private hot tub on the decking area, perfect for relaxing evenings under the stars.

Is this property pet-friendly?

No, pets are not permitted at this property, ensuring a pet-free environment for guests during their stay.

What type of heating is available in the accommodation?

The property is equipped with electric central heating and also features a cosy woodburning stove for added warmth and ambiance.

Is there parking available on site?

Yes, there is off-road parking available for one car, providing convenient access to the accommodation.

Are there any cooking facilities in the accommodation?

The accommodation includes a kitchenette with a 2-ring hob and microwave, suitable for preparing light meals and snacks.

Can I access the internet during my stay?

Yes, the property is equipped with broadband/WiFi, allowing guests to stay connected during their visit.
